datagrid的前台和后台问题
前台代码:
<asp:DataGrid id="DataGridPC" runat="server" >
<EditItemStyle BackColor="#004000">
</EditItemStyle>
<AlternatingItemStyle BorderColor="Lime" BackColor="Bisque">
</AlternatingItemStyle>
<HeaderStyle BackColor="Aqua">
</HeaderStyle>
<Columns>
<asp:BoundColumn DataField="KANRIBANGOU" HeaderText="管理NO"></asp:BoundColumn>
<asp:BoundColumn DataField="MAC" HeaderText="MAC"></asp:BoundColumn>
<asp:BoundColumn DataField="NIC" HeaderText="NIC"></asp:BoundColumn>
<asp:BoundColumn DataField="MEMORY" HeaderText="Memory"></asp:BoundColumn>
<asp:BoundColumn DataField="DISK" HeaderText="DISK"></asp:BoundColumn>
<asp:BoundColumn DataField="CPU" HeaderText="CPU"></asp:BoundColumn>
<asp:BoundColumn DataField="CHIPSET" HeaderText="Chip Set"></asp:BoundColumn>
<asp:BoundColumn DataField="BIKOU" HeaderText="備考"></asp:BoundColumn>
<asp:BoundColumn DataField="TIMESTAMP" HeaderText="時間"></asp:BoundColumn>
<asp:HyperLinkColumn
HeaderText="詳細表示"
DataNavigateUrlField="KANRIBANGOU"
DataNavigateUrlFormatString="detailspage.aspx?id={0}"
DataTextField="KANRIBANGOU"
Target="_new"
/>
</Columns>
</asp:DataGrid>
后台代码:
Dim strsql As String
strsql = "select * from T_PC_KOUSEI;"
Dim objDataAdapter1 As New SqlDataAdapter(strsql, myConnection)
Dim objdataSet1 As New DataSet
objDataAdapter1.Fill(objdataSet1)
DataGridPC.DataSource = objdataSet1
DataGridPC.DataBind()
结果如下:-----------问题所在
管理NO MAC NIC Memory DISK CPU ChipSet 備考 時間 詳細表示 ---前台作用的结果
001 001 11 11 11 001 001 System.Byte[] hx001 ---从表取出来的值
KANRIBANGOU MAC NIC MEMORY DISK CPU CHIPSET BIKOU ---后台作用的结果
001 001 11 11 11 001 001 System.Byte[] hx001
其中(KANRIBANGOU MAC NIC MEMORY DISK CPU CHIPSET BIKOU 是数据库表的字段)
可是现在我只想要前台作用的结果。怎么办?高手相救呀